Clear Signs Your Home Needs a Water Softener
Stubborn Limescale Buildup
You see crusty, white deposits forming around faucet spouts, showerheads, and creeping across your glass shower doors. These are heavy mineral deposits, primarily calcium and magnesium, left behind as hard water evaporates on your surfaces. No matter how much you scrub or how much vinegar you use, the chalky residue always returns within a few days.Beyond being incredibly unsightly, this limescale restricts water flow in your fixtures and ruins the finish on expensive plumbing hardware. If left untreated, these same deposits build up inside your pipes, eventually leading to severe blockages and reduced water pressure throughout the house. A whole-home water softening system stops this scaling process entirely, keeping your fixtures looking clean and functioning perfectly.
Dry, Itchy Skin and Dull Hair
Your skin feels unusually dry, flaky, or itchy immediately after showering, and your hair might feel rough or difficult to manage even with heavy conditioners. Hard water minerals actively prevent your soap and shampoo from lathering effectively in the shower. Instead of washing away cleanly, the minerals combine with the soap to leave a microscopic film on your body.This invisible film strips away your natural oils and traps dirt against your skin, leading to ongoing irritation and exacerbating conditions like eczema. Your personal grooming routines become far less effective, and you spend more money on specialized moisturizers trying to fix a problem caused by your plumbing. Softening your water removes these minerals, allowing your soaps to rinse away completely for softer skin and healthier hair.
Dingy Laundry and Stiff Fabrics
Your white clothes look yellowed, bright colors appear dull, and fabrics feel stiff or scratchy after washing. Hard water minerals react aggressively with your laundry detergents, preventing a thorough clean and leaving behind a curd-like residue. This residue embeds deep into the fabric fibers of your clothing, towels, and bedsheets during every wash cycle.Over time, this mineral buildup breaks down the fibers, reducing the lifespan of your favorite clothes and turning soft towels into sandpaper. You are forced to use much more detergent, fabric softener, and hotter water just to get acceptable results. Treating the water before it reaches your washing machine protects your wardrobe and drastically improves the feel of your laundry.
Reduced Appliance Efficiency
Your dishwasher leaves cloudy spots on your glassware, and your washing machine struggles to get clothes clean despite running on heavy-duty cycles. Mineral buildup inside these appliances forces their internal motors and pumps to work much harder to push water through the system. This excessive strain leads to increased energy consumption and a significantly shortened operational life for your expensive home investments.Your water heating system is especially vulnerable to this type of damage. When hard water is heated, the minerals separate and bake onto the heating elements, causing the unit to make strange popping or rumbling noises. This forces the system to run longer to heat the same amount of water, driving up your monthly utility bills and leading to premature failure.
Why Your Culver City Home Has Hard Water Problems
Naturally Hard Water Supply
The water supplied to Culver City, whether imported from regional aqueducts or drawn from local groundwater, naturally contains high levels of dissolved calcium and magnesium. These heavy minerals are picked up as the water flows through miles of rock and soil before it ever reaches the municipal treatment facility. Because Southern California relies heavily on these mineral-rich sources, hard water is simply a geographic reality for local residents.Municipal water facilities treat the water to ensure it is safe to drink, but they do not remove the hardness-causing minerals. This means the heavy water flows directly into your home's plumbing system completely untreated for scale. Installing a water softener is the only effective way to intercept and remove these minerals before they can cause damage.
Aging Plumbing Infrastructure
Over decades of use, untreated hard water deposits thick layers of scale inside pipes, narrowing their internal diameter and severely reducing your home's overall water pressure. Many older Culver City homes still rely on their original plumbing systems, meaning they have endured years of constant mineral buildup. This internal scaling creates friction, which wears down the pipe walls and makes them highly susceptible to pinhole leaks and severe corrosion.Even if you have a newer home, the constant flow of hard water begins damaging fresh pipes from day one. A new water softening system protects your existing plumbing infrastructure from any further degradation. It acts as an insurance policy for your pipes, extending their lifespan and preventing the need for massive whole-house repiping projects.
Water Heater Strain from Mineral Buildup
Hard water minerals undergo a chemical reaction when exposed to high temperatures, precipitating out of the water and forming a thick layer of solid scale. This scale coats the inside of your water heating tank and completely covers the vital heating elements. Because we are residential water heating specialists, we see firsthand how quickly this mineral rock destroys heating systems in our local area.The scale acts as an insulator, forcing the unit to heat the mineral rock first before it can actually heat your water. This drastically reduces the efficiency of the unit, increases your energy costs, and inevitably causes the tank to rupture or the elements to burn out. A water softener prevents this scale from ever forming, ensuring your hot water supply remains reliable and efficient.
